My story

Here's what the humans have to say about me:

Louise is a charming and affectionate orange lady, seeking the warmth and security of an indoor-only home where she can reign supreme as the center of attention. With a heart as golden as her fur, she adores the company of children and thrives in their playful presence. However, Louise prefers to be the sole pet in the household, relishing in the undivided affection and pampering of her human companions.

Her love for the finer things in life is evident in her fondness for wet food, plush cat beds, lofty cat towers, and cozy window perches, all meticulously arranged to suit her royal tastes. Louise's vocal nature becomes particularly apparent when she's hungry, demanding attention and sustenance with her melodic meows. With an array of toys, kitty couches, and catnip to indulge her every whim, Louise's days are filled with joy and contentment as she rules over her kingdom with grace and charm.

More about this shelter

Our Vision:

A compassionate community that promotes a safe and humane life for all animals.

Our Mission:

The GAHS enriches lives; supporting and engaging the community by providing effective, accessible and innovative services and advocacy for animals.

How we pursue our mission:

• We shelter companion animals in need and place them in loving homes.

• We provide information to our community to promote humane treatment for all animals.

• We provide community support programs to help people provide better lives for their pets.

• We expand access to essential veterinary care and behavioral support for companion animals.

• We prioritize reunification of lost pets with the families who love them.
